Started in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been concentrated to reducing the time to market for innovators producing new medical devices. The company stands out by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times typically between 1 to 3 days—an achievement not achievable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ard understood the critical need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for highly active development programs innovating inn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is crucial in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old major value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Besides rout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Medical Device Sterilization Matters

Preventing infections remains a mainstay of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Adequate sterilization of medical devices substantially re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ers as well. Deficient sterilization can give rise to outbreaks of critical di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Procedures for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has evolved dramatically over the last century, using a variety of methods suited to various types of devices and materials. Some of the most widely used techniques include:

Sterilization Using Autoclaves

Autoclaving remains the most popular and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is quick, affordable, and sustainable,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

State-of-the-art Materials and Device Complexity

The rise of advanced med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ization processes capable of handling sensitive materials. Enhancements in sterilization include methods especially low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ging delicate components.
